
“G-d blessed the seventh day and sanctified it, for on that day G-d rested.”(Bereshit 2:3)
So after H”S created all existence on the seventh day, he created rest.
Rest is also a creation and a very important one. Today studies have proven that many illnesses come from lack of rest.
We should not take rest for granted, we should appreciate the gift it is. But what is rest for us (playing golf, going to the beach, watching movies, shopping, etc…) is not the rest H”S created on the seventh day. The rest He created was that He stopped his creative process and He allowed everything to be.
The Creator declares: ”My children be happy, for I give you that which is very good.”
“Knowledge of what you possess is true wealth. If you are unaware of what you have, or are only faintly aware of its true nature, you actually do not possess it.” (Rabbi Zelig Pliskin “Growth Through Torah)
H”S gave us Shabbat as a gift and He informed us about it. He didn’t want us to take this gift for granted, but the only way to appreciate it and know the value of it is if we keep it.
